Knicks legend and current broadcaster Walt Frazier has entered into COVID-19 protocols, joining three of their players, according to a source. He is expected to miss 10 days as the virus keeps spreading within the organization.
Frazier turned 76 last March. He was recently on a holiday hiatus around Thanksgiving but was on the San Antonio-Indiana-Toronto road trip where the Knicks seemed to have picked up the virus.
In addition to Frazier, the Knicks have three players out due to COVID-19 – Obi Toppin, RJ Barrett and Quentin Grimes. The rookie Grimes tested positive on Tuesday, according to a source.

Carolina Hurricanes have four more players test positive for COVID-19; game vs. Minnesota Wild postponed
The game between the Hurricanes and Minnesota Wild on Tuesday night has been postponed after four additional Carolina players tested positive.
The Hurricanes had positive tests come in for Jordan Staal, Andrei Svechnikov, Ian Cole and Steven Lorentz after Tuesday’s morning skate in Minnesota, the team announced, which led the league to believe it could be an active transmission.
